Georgia Department of Public Health in Albany, GA is seeking an Emergency Management Specialist/Training Coordinator, Level 1 or 2, to support the Southwest Public Health District 8-2. This in-office role serves the 14-county district, coordinating training, drills, and exercises and ensuring HIPAA compliance.
The position involves assessing training needs, evaluating outcomes, and participating in emergency preparedness planning. Some weekend/evening work and travel for events may be required.
